Crystallization – the Hidden Dimension of Hedge Funds' Fee Structure
ELAUT, G.; FRÖMMEL, M.; SJÖDIN, J. - Faculteit Economie en Bedrijfskunde, Universiteit Gent - 2014
We investigate the implications of variations in the frequency with which hedge fund managers update their high-water mark on fees paid by investors. We rst doc- ument the crystallization frequencies used by Commodity Trading Advisors (CTAs) and then perform simulations and a bootstrap analysis....

Changes in the fees on payment services and the structure of payments following the introduction of the financial transaction tax
Ilyés, Tamás; Takács, Kristóf; Varga, Lóránt - In: MNB Bulletin 9 (2014) 1, pp. 40-47
Payment service providers passed the transaction tax on to their clients in several steps and to a significant degree, both in the spring, upon introduction of the tax, and in the autumn, when the rates of tax were raised. For cash withdrawals and bank transfers, the tax was typically passed on...

An Economic Analysis of Deferred Examination System: Evidence from Policy Reforms in Japan
Yamauchi, Isamu; Nagaoka, Sadao - Institute of Innovation Research, Hitotsubashi University - 2014
We investigate how a deferred patent examination system promotes ex-ante screening of patent applications, which reduces both the number of granted patents and the use of economic resources for examinations, without reducing the return from R&D. Based on a real option theory, we develop a model...

Three Essays on Hedge Fund Fee Structure, Return Smoothing and Gross Performance
Feng, Shuang - 2011
Hedge funds feature special compensation structure compared to traditional investments. Previous studies mainly focus on the provisions and incentive structure of hedge fund contract, such as 2/20, hurdle rates, and high-water mark. The first essay develops an algorithm to empirically estimate...

Taking Private Equity Fees apart
Thorsell, Håkan - Economics Institute for Research (SIR), … - 2010
In this paper I build a simplified model of the remuneration structure of a private equity fund using option theory. This model is then used to analyze the relative importance of the fixed and variable fee parts. The model is complemented with a structural model to evaluate the financial choices...
